As in the match with Villeurbanne, so against Unix Kazan Panathinaikos did not take advantage of the factor … OAKA and was defeated 74-72.
The “greens” were not convinced throughout the match that they can get the pink card, while once again the failure cost them dearly, mainly from the periphery.

“Wound” again the shots outside the 6.75m: The defeat of Panathinaikos by Unix Kazan was the third consecutive and second series in OAKA. The common denominator of all three matches were the three-pointers, where the percentage of “clover” was less than 30%. That is, against the Russians, the players of Prifti had 7/28 (25%), with the Red Star in Belgrade they shot 3/22 (13.6%) and in the defeat by Villeurbanne they had 5/19 (26.3%) .
The advantage in rebounds is almost untapped: With the presence of the amazing Papagiannis, Panathinaikos had a clear superiority in the racket. The Greek center got 17 rebounds alone, while the “clover” had a total of 14 forwards, against only 8 of Unix. However, the only 16 points from second chances that the “greens” got is a relatively small harvest.
The mediocre night of the leaders: The last shot is like the. Prayer. He enters and you become a hero or he does not enter and the lights (in the negative sense) go on you. Usually, though, it is a shot in very difficult conditions. Papapetrou was the one who got it for the “clover”, but he did not find a target and so the defeat was fatal. However, the leader of the “greens” was generally in a bad night, as the 4/15 shots, of which 2/11 three-pointers, are not a representative performance of his quality. At the same time, the “greens” could not rely on the well-closed Meikon, who from the good defense of the Russians did not take the ball easily, while Panathinaikos did not get anything from Nemanja Nedovic, who played for just 3:31 ”, coming from an injury.
